On August 18–20 and October 13, 2013, two self-development workshops were held this year for the students of the age group 14–16 from Bombay International School, Mumbai. 

When the students came in August they had two sessions at the Society House. The first one was by Harvinder on observation and sensitivity. She sent the students out into the Society House garden to observe any one plant and write about it with an inner awareness and sensitivity. The exercise sharpened the senses and also encouraged creative perception. They also had another activity wherein one of the students was blindfolded and was made to identify his friends by touching the faces of those who lay down in a circle. 

The next session was by Amir from Auroville. It was on generating complete sensory awareness through one’s body. It involved trust in which the participant had to relax muscle by muscle with the help of a partner. It was a deeply relaxing session of two hours. 

When they came again in October 2013, apart from the others, the students had one session of Yogasanas for two hours facilitated by Anahita, a school teacher who has been coordinating the visit of the students for several years.
